Portrait of a smiling man with a quill pen(?), pottery inkwell (?) and what looks like a type of stereo viewer but is more probably a polygraph copying machine.
The Beard Patentee mount was added to protect the plate and does not belong with it.
Sold at Chiswick Auctions 28/5/2021 lot number 16 for £750.
